Thomas Jefferson Flanagan was an artist and activist from Florence, GA. Fishing on the Quarters is a landscape painting with a large tree and a person fishing from a body of water. The tree and fisherman are in the foreground, while a wooden gate borders an acreage of colorful crops painted linearly.
